This is not an easy time for Siddharth Malhotra. Heart-throb of the Instagram generation, he may still be,but after the resounding failure of five films in a row Baar Baar Dekho, A Gentleman, Ittefaq, Aiyyari, Jabariya Jodi, one a bigger flop than the other, Siddharth Malhotra seems all set for a turn-around in his career with Marjaavan which releases this Friday.
The Milap Zaveri-directed film features Malhotra on a vendetta spree against Ritesh Deshmukhwho plays a midget. Deshmukh is the first pint-sized villain of Hindi cinema, and pre-release reports suggest he has completely stolen the show with his miniaturized vile act.
However Siddharth Malhotra need not worry. Even if Desmukh is the scenestealer in Marjavaan Malhotra’s role and performance has enough meat and bite to put him back on the map once again.
A sequel to Marjavaan is already being planned where Malhotra’s role would be further developed.
